How are children falling victim to far-right extremists?

A Sky News investigation has found that children, including some under the age of 10, are being recruited into extremist far-right organisations.

Our research can reveal there has been a dramatic increase in the number of youngsters being referred to government counter-extremist programmes.

It comes as counter-terror police announce a new campaign aimed at preventing radicalisation - especially during lockdown.

On this episode of the Sky News Daily Podcast, host Katerina Vittozzi speaks to 'John' - who was manipulated and groomed by far-right forums aged just 14. His mother 'Sarah' tells us how she discovered her son was an extremist.

We also speak to former neo-Nazi Nigel Bromage from Exit UK and Patrik Hermansson from Hope not Hate about how we can protect and save children from far-right groups.
